#457340 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#457340 is composed of 27.1% red, 45.1%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.3%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 114.1 degrees, a saturation of 28.5% and a lightness of 35.1%. #457340 color hex could be obtained by blending #8ae680 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#457340 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#457340 has RGB values of R:69, G:115,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4551488.

Shades and Tints of #457340
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#457340
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565e55 is the less saturated color, while #13b102 is the most saturated one.
